Patent number: 9183590Abstract: Methods and systems using a single centralized database to manage postal accounting data are provided. The central database may interface with remote postal meters by way of one or more transient data collectors, which cache data from associated meters and transmit the data to the central database. The data collectors also validate postage accounts to the associated meters. The use of local transient data collectors allows for a single centralized database to be used without requiring data replication among databases local to each computer that manages postal meters.Type: GrantFiled: July 20, 2010Date of Patent: November 10, 2015Assignee: Neopost TechnologiesInventor: Sean Angelone

Patent number: 9156305Abstract: An inserting system has an envelope feeding station, an enclosure feeding station, and a folding station having a first and a second folding nip for folding documents. Documents are inserted into envelopes, which are held in an inserting position. Envelopes are transported through an envelope transport path from their feeding station to the inserting position, and enclosures are transported through an enclosure transport path from their feeding station to the inserting position. The enclosure transport path comprises a diverter, a first enclosure transport path part between the enclosure feeding station and the diverter and a second enclosure transport path part between the diverter and the inserting position. The second enclosure transport path part passes through the first and the second folding nip. A third enclosure transport path part is present between the diverter and the inserting position and bypasses the first folding nip and passes through the second folding nip.Type: GrantFiled: January 30, 2012Date of Patent: October 13, 2015Assignee: NEOPOST TECHNOLOGIESInventors: Herman Sytema, Fransiscus Hermannus Feijen

Patent number: 9151661Abstract: A method of determining the dimensions of a parcel, in which method the parcel to be measured is placed against an orthogonal reference support made up of at least two perpendicular vertical side panels, each of which is provided with a grid, and an image of the support and of the parcel together is acquired so as to determine at least three perpendicular edges of the parcel, and then the number of intervals of the grid that form each of the edges is counted so as to obtain the dimensions in mm of the parcel.Type: GrantFiled: September 30, 2011Date of Patent: October 6, 2015Assignee: NEOPOST TECHNOLOGIESInventors: Laurent Farlotti, Ruben Rico

Patent number: 9143487Abstract: System for remote firmware updates of mail processing device from a remote data server including: file download servers connected to the remote data server for receiving encrypted files encrypted from a list of binary files corresponding to firmware of a mail processing device to update; web servers providing a web service application for downloading files and connected to the remote data server and the files download servers for retrieving the encrypted files associated with a personalized files catalog retrieved from the remote data server; and a user computer system connected to the web servers for receiving the encrypted files for download onto a storage device to plug into the mail processing device. The mail processing device decrypts the encrypted files with file decryption keys previously provided with the personalized files catalog and installs the files before connecting to the remote data server for report the outcome of the installation.Type: GrantFiled: January 16, 2014Date of Patent: September 22, 2015Assignee: NEOPOST TECHNOLOGIESInventors: Silviu Sopco, Seton Hodonou, Herve Bienaime, Nathalie Tortellier

Patent number: 9135149Abstract: Systems and methods for generating and traversing test cases trees are provided. A test case tree indicates an order of execution for multiple test cases, where setup and tear down or equivalent steps are not required before and after execution of each test case in the tree. The tree may allow for generation of virtual test cases to encompass multiple test cases which ordinarily would have mutually exclusive execution requirements.Type: GrantFiled: January 11, 2012Date of Patent: September 15, 2015Assignee: Neopost TechnologiesInventors: Robert W. Perin, Garret Blue

Publication number: 20150219566Abstract: A system for detecting double-feed flat item conveyed in a mail processing machine, including a detection for directing a beam of radiant energy toward the moving flat items, scanning them with the beam and receiving at least a portion of the beam of radiation reflected from them. The detector includes a triangulation sensor for providing an output proportional to the position at which the reflected portion of the beam is received, and means for determining from the output, the distance (d) between the radiation source and the point of reflection of the beam on the moving flat items, and providing a signal (S) representative of said distance; and a controller configured to receive the signal (S) and generate an output signal (V) indicative of a flat item profile and a double-feed condition when it detects a significant break point or slope change of the signal from a first direction to a second direction.Type: ApplicationFiled: January 27, 2015Publication date: August 6, 2015Applicant: NEOPOST TECHNOLOGIESInventor: David AUDEON

Publication number: 20150127571Abstract: Systems and techniques are disclosed that allow a mailer to obtain confirmation of a current address from a recipient, and/or an express request from the recipient to update a mailing address stored by the mailer. In an embodiment, a mailer may send a first mail piece to the recipient, which directs the recipient to access a website or other electronic resource to verify his or her address. Upon receiving express confirmation of the recipient's address, a second mail piece may be sent to the current address, and/or the recipient's address may be updated in the mailer's records.Type: ApplicationFiled: November 6, 2013Publication date: May 7, 2015Applicant: Neopost TechnologiesInventor: Michael Bogad

Patent number: 8950165Abstract: In an apparatus for inserting a postal item into an envelope, the envelope is fed with its flap fold trailing its envelope body and its flap along a flap opener. A free flap opener edge enters between the flap and the envelope body until the flap fold abuts the free flap opener edge. While holding the flap against the flap opener, the flap is pivoted relative to the envelope body about the flap fold to an open position and subsequently the postal item is inserted into the envelope body. An apparatus for carrying such a method is also described.Type: GrantFiled: May 20, 2009Date of Patent: February 10, 2015Assignee: Neopost TechnologiesInventor: Fransiscus Hermannus Feijen
